Perry was discovered floating face-down in a jacuzzi at his LA dwelling on Oct. 28, 2023. It was decided he died from the ‘acute results of ketamine’.
“In his plea settlement, Plasencia admitted that a few month earlier than Perry’s demise, he illegally equipped the actor with 20 vials of ketamine, which totaled 100 mg, together with ketamine lozenges and syringes. The physician additionally admitted to enlisting one other physician, Mark Chavez, to produce the drug for him, in line with the courtroom paperwork.
After promoting the medicine to Perry for $4,500, Plasencia allegedly requested Chavez if he might preserve supplying them so they may turn into Perry’s ‘go-to’, prosecutors stated.
[…] Jasveen Sangha, often called the ‘Ketamine Queen’, who’s charged with supplying the medicine that brought on Perry’s demise, is anticipated to be sentenced on Dec. 10. In August, Sangha beforehand pleaded responsible to 3 counts of distribution of ketamine, one rely of distribution of ketamine leading to demise or critical bodily harm and one rely of sustaining a drug-involved premises.”
